Ecuador's ambassador to the UK has left London to return home for talks on the WikiLeaks founder Julian Assange's application for political asylum.
Anna Alban is travelling to meet Ecuador's president, Rafael Correa, in the capital Quito, where she will personally brief him on Assange's application. She will also hold a series of meetings at the foreign ministry.
Assange arrived at Ecuador's embassy on Tuesday in the latest dramatic twist in his fight to avoid extradition to Sweden, where he is wanted for questioning over alleged sex offences.
A spokesman for the Ecuadorean embassy said: "Ecuador presently finds itself in a unique situation and it is important that those responsible making the final decision on Mr Assange's application are fully briefed on all aspects of the present situation."
